Focus & Fix Eye Primer – £1.25
Having never used one, this is a whole new world. Eyeshadow drives me mad as it looks good before I leave the house and is basically non-existent by the time I get anywhere! This helped enhance the colour as well as keep eyeshadow on!
Amazing Curl Mascara (Black) – £2.00
I didn’t expect much from this, as with any cheap mascara. I tried it out and was really impressed! The curve helped lift the lashes a bit and the colour was strong. One coat made a difference, but for a stronger look, I’d do two. One coat is my everyday use though.
Pro F102 Concealer Brush – £1.99
I used this for concealer and it was fine, but I still find I have to use a blender to really work concealer in. I got another idea and used it with the cream contour. It created great lines to work with and made my first contouring effort super easy so I just use it for that now.
Pro F103 Stippling Brush – £3.49
I have been looking at these for a while, reading reviews, etc. I actually had one in my Amazon basket that cost about £12 ready to buy. When I saw this for so little, I had to try it! I’ve never used one before, but it seriously works so well! I put liquid foundation on the back of my hand and dabbed the brush in it a bit. I then applied it and the foundation blended so well.
Pro Curve Contour Foundation Brush FF01 – £2.95 (was half price!)
To be honest, I have no idea how to use this thing. I haven’t tried. I will report back!
Ultra 32 Eyeshadow Palette Flawless Matte – £8.00
I’m in love! I hardly ever find eyeshadow that I like. They always have that annoying shimmer that I just don’t want on a normal day. These are matte matte matte, and there are so many colours that I can play about with lots of different looks. Before having this set I always used the same old eyeshadows, but now I’ve definitely improved on that area.
Ultra Cream Contour Palette – £8.00
Yet another new thing to me. I’ve used powdered contouring kits and they’re fine. They do…something. Again, lazy with make up, so not the best judge, but I gave a proper go, and it worked so well. It was easy to glide on and blend in, but definitely made a difference to the overall look.
The annoying thing for me is that I only use 3 colours really, and have almost hit pan already on the highlighter.
Unicorn Lipstick (Pink Myth) – £1
Unicorn Lipstick (Legend) – £1
I bought these lipsticks purely because they were £1.Why would I not! Also, I have a lot of subtle lip colours and reds, etc. So I thought I’d go for bright pink and a purple colour.
I didn’t expect to be so impressed by these. They actually stay on, unlike other cheap lipsticks, and the colour is really pigmented and as bright as it looks online. I don’t think they’ll be up there with my most worn, but they’re definitely fun.
